Holton begins with the Native Americans who struggled to save their land, compelling British officials to fortify the frontier, in turn requiring taxes on white colonists that inflamed their anger at the mother country. He ends with an analysis of the economic origins and effects of the U.S. Constitution. Holton also offers a fresh take on every major battle of the Revolution, from Lexington and Concord, to the British surrender at Yorktown and beyond.
